### What Makes Green Hydrogen Stand Out?
“Among renewables, green hydrogen is particularly exciting,” says Stanislav Kondrashov. Differing from conventional forms, green hydrogen is created using electrolysis powered by renewables—a zero-emission process.
One major advantage is the absence of greenhouse gases during production and use. As decarbonization becomes a top priority, green hydrogen fits perfectly into a sustainable strategy.
